The most common reasons a 2019 Nissan NV1500 radiator fan isn't working are the fan assembly, the fan clutch, or the coolant temperature sensor.
  • Fan Motor or Clutch: A faulty fan motor or a malfunctioning fan clutch can result in inadequate cooling, causing the engine to overheat.
  • Fan Relay or Fuse: A faulty fan relay or blown fuse can prevent the cooling fan from operating, leading to engine overheating.
  • Temp Sensor or Fan Control Module: A faulty temperature sensor or fan control module can result in incorrect readings, causing the engine to overheat or the cooling fan to operate improperly.

The first indication of a defective fan clutch is a healthy cooling system that runs below or above the normal temperature range. This is due to the fan running too fast or too slow. Also, a seized cooling fan will cause a loud roaring fan noise from under the hood every time the accelerator is pressed, and the engine will feel as if it lacks power. In this situation it would be very difficult to turn the engine cooling fan by hand, of course when the vehicle is off. Finally, if the clutch fails the fan will either turn very slowly, and not respond well to engine speed.

The bad thermostat can cause two different sets of problems, depending on whether it's stuck open or stuck closed.

A thermostat that is stuck open can cause the engine to run colder than normal and turn on the check engine light. It may also cause poor fuel mileage and the heater to blow cool air.

A thermostat that is stuck closed will cause the vehicle to overheat. If a new thermostat doesn't resolve engine temperature problems, the cooling system needs to be checked for other issues.

When the engine coolant temperature sensor fails, it will send inaccurate information to the vehicle’s computer, causing the computer to react to false operating conditions. This will cause the engine to consume more fuel than normal, depleting fuel mileage, and causing black, sooty smoke from the engine under moderate to heavy acceleration. The check engine light will illuminate, and on-board diagnostic trouble codes may be stored for exhaust and emission system failure, fuel delivery system failure, and engine cooling system failure. Overheating may also occur, as the coolant sensor may be leaking fluid out of the engine, creating a an air pocket in the system.

What steps should I take to diagnose the non-functioning radiator fan in my 2019 Nissan NV1500?

To effectively diagnose the non-functioning radiator fan in your 2019 Nissan NV1500, begin with the simplest solutions before progressing to more complex diagnostics. Start by checking the fuse associated with the radiator fan, as a blown fuse is a common and easily fixable issue. If the fuse is intact, move on to inspect the relay, which controls the power to the fan; testing or replacing a faulty relay can restore functionality. Next, test the fan motor by applying direct power to it; if it fails to operate, the motor may need replacement. Additionally, verify the temperature sensor, as it plays a crucial role in signaling the fan to activate when the engine reaches a specific temperature. Don’t overlook the wiring connected to the fan; look for any signs of damage, loose connections, or corrosion that could impede performance. Finally, ensure that coolant levels are adequate, as low coolant can lead to overheating and affect the fan's operation. By following this structured approach, you can systematically identify and resolve the issue with your radiator fan.

What are the common causes for the radiator fan not working in a 2019 Nissan NV1500?

When troubleshooting a non-functioning radiator fan in a 2019 Nissan NV1500, it's essential to consider several common problems that could be at play. A faulty fan motor is often the primary suspect, as it directly impacts the fan's ability to cool the radiator. Additionally, a blown fuse can interrupt the power supply to the fan, rendering it inoperative. Another critical component to check is the relay, which is responsible for sending power to the fan motor; if this relay fails, the fan will not operate. The coolant temperature sensor also plays a vital role, as it signals when the fan should engage; a malfunctioning sensor may fail to trigger the fan when needed. Furthermore, wiring issues, such as damaged or corroded connections, can disrupt the electrical flow to the fan. Lastly, the cooling fan module, which controls the fan's operation, may also be defective, preventing the fan from turning on. How urgent is it to repair the non-functioning radiator fan in a 2019 Nissan NV1500?

Repairing the non-functioning radiator fan in your 2019 Nissan NV1500 is an urgent matter that should not be overlooked. The radiator fan is essential for maintaining optimal engine temperature by effectively dissipating heat generated during operation. When this fan fails, the risk of overheating increases dramatically, which can lead to severe engine damage, including warped cylinder heads and blown head gaskets. Such issues not only compromise the vehicle's performance but can also result in costly repairs or even a complete engine replacement.
